Downtown Dayton safety draws focus of elected officials, business leaders

DAYTON, Ohio (WKEF) — Congressman Mike Turner, other elected officials and business leaders held a news conference on Monday to present their recommendations to improve the safety of downtown Dayton.

A working group that included those present today, along with law enforcement, Dayton commissioners and Montgomery County commissioners came together at the end of last summer and formed a working group to tackle the problem of safety downtown Dayton.

“Everybody’s working on the problem, but there hasn’t been a whole lot of coordination, and so, what our effort has been is how do we bring more of each of these things, but also, how do we coordinate them so everyone’s working together?” said Rep. Turner…
